有可能是由于文件路徑錯誤、文件編碼問題、文件格式不規范等原因導致R語言讀取csv文件失敗。以下是一些解決方法:
確保文件路徑正確:檢查文件路徑是否正確,可以使用getwd()函數查看當前工作目錄,使用setwd()函數設置工作目錄。
檢查文件編碼:使用read.csv()函數時,可以指定文件編碼參數,例如encoding="UTF-8"或encoding="GBK"等。
檢查文件格式:確保csv文件的列數、分隔符等格式正確,可以使用read.csv()函數的參數sep指定分隔符。
嘗試使用其他讀取函數:除了read.csv()函數,還可以嘗試使用read.table()、read.csv2()等函數來讀取csv文件。
使用其他包:如果以上方法無法解決問題,可以嘗試使用其他包如data.table、readr等來讀取csv文件。
如果以上方法仍無法解決問題,建議檢查csv文件是否損壞或者嘗試從其他來源獲取相同的數據文件。